Hiring somebody to acquire unauthorized access to an account that does not belong to you is illegal in most jurisdictions. In the United States, the Computer Fraud and Abuse Act (CFAA) prohibits accessing a computer or network without permission.

When a private "employs a hacker" to bypass security for harmful reasons, they become an accomplice to a federal criminal offense. However, employing an expert to audit one's own company page or to assist in recuperating one's own personal account refers service for hire, provided the approaches used align with Facebook's Terms of Service and regional privacy laws.

4. Can a hacker recover an account that has been erased?
As soon as an account is completely deleted, there is a really short window (typically 30 days) throughout which it can be recovered. After that window, the data is typically purged from Facebook's active servers, and even a Top Hacker For Hire-tier hacker can not retrieve it.
5. What is a "Bug Bounty" program?
Facebook (Meta) has a genuine program where they pay ethical hackers to discover and report vulnerabilities in their system. This is the greatest level of professional hacking engagement.
